Job Summary
The Sr. Manager, Foundations Engineering leads the day-to-day engineering execution, operational reliability, and platform delivery of the Foundations Engineering function within Ad Platforms - the internal capability layer that powers every service, application, and system in the organization. The organization owns and operates portions of the Ad Platforms infrastructure and developer platform stack directly, while also extending, operationalizing, and supporting shared enterprise platforms within the Ad Platforms ecosystem.
This includes leadership across platform engineering and DevOps, cloud infrastructure and runtime operations, SRE and reliability practices, database administration, observability enablement, and the infrastructure and platform capabilities supporting the Data Platform, BI ecosystem, and AI agentic and real-time ML platform. This role partners closely with centralized Platform Engineering and Infrastructure teams responsible for shared enterprise services and cloud platforms. This role reports to the Director, Product Software Engineering - AI Engineering + Foundations Engineering.

Responsibilities and Duties of the Role:
Platform Engineering & DevOps
Manages and delivers the platform engineering and DevOps capabilities that power software delivery across Ad Platforms - including ownership and operational support of CI/CD systems, Kubernetes and container orchestration environments, Infrastructure-as-Code modules, deployment automation, shared cloud platform integrations across AWS (primary), Azure, and GCP, and internal developer tooling - improving deployment speed, reliability, scalability, and developer experience.
Drives automation-first operational practices, golden-path engineering patterns, self-service engineering capabilities, and Ads-specific platform abstractions built on top of shared infrastructure platforms - accelerating engineering velocity, reducing operational toil, and improving onboarding, deployment reliability, and release consistency across Ad Platforms teams.
Serves as a primary operational ownership layer for Ad Platforms workloads running on shared infrastructure and platform services - partnering closely with centralized Platform Engineering organizations responsible for core cloud, Kubernetes, CI/CD, and observability platforms.
Implements and enforces secure-by-default platform standards across Ad Platforms environments and delivery pipelines - including secrets management, deployment governance, engineering quality gates, vulnerability remediation, auditability, and compliance controls - in partnership with Security and centralized infrastructure teams.
Develops internal developer tooling and web-based operational interfaces that support service deployment, runtime management, and engineering productivity across Ad Platforms.
Reliability, Data & AI Platform Infrastructure
Establishes and operates reliability engineering practices across Ad Platforms foundational services and runtime environments - including SLO/SLI frameworks, incident management rigor, production readiness standards, operational health monitoring, and resiliency engineering practices - driving measurable improvements in uptime, stability, and deployment confidence.
Leads observability operations and enablement across Ad Platforms - including logging, monitoring, distributed tracing, alerting frameworks, and operational instrumentation standards - partnering with centralized observability teams to ensure consistent and actionable visibility into system behavior and platform health.
Leads database engineering operations and data infrastructure enablement for Ad Platforms, including operational reliability, backup and recovery strategy, failover readiness, performance optimization, and modernization efforts across relational, NoSQL, and cloud-native data systems supporting transactional services, analytics, BI, and Data Platform workloads.
Builds and operates infrastructure and platform capabilities supporting AI agentic and real-time ML systems - including orchestration runtimes, inference platform enablement, GPU and compute orchestration, deployment automation, and governance-aligned operational frameworks - enabling AI Engineering teams to develop, deploy, and scale AI systems reliably and safely.
Executes FinOps and cost management practices across multi-cloud infrastructure and AI inference workloads - including capacity planning, cloud spend visibility, utilization optimization, waste reduction, and unit cost reporting - contributing to engineering efficiency and responsible resource utilization.
Leverages observability signals and automation to drive anomaly detection, incident prevention, and intelligent alerting across Ad Platforms services and platforms.
Team Leadership & Delivery
Leads, develops, and grows a high-performing engineering organization across Foundations Engineering's platform domains - managing engineers and technical leads directly, driving hiring and performance management, establishing execution cadence, and fostering a culture of operational excellence, accountability, continuous improvement, and engineering craft.
Owns delivery execution and roadmap commitments across Foundations Engineering domains - planning quarterly work, coordinating dependencies with AI Engineering, Product Engineering, Security, Data, and centralized Platform teams, leading postmortems and operational reviews, and continuously improving delivery predictability, production quality, and platform health.
Required Education, Experience/Skills/Training:
10+ years of software engineering experience, with demonstrated depth in platform engineering, cloud infrastructure, DevOps, SRE, or related foundations disciplines.
Proven people management experience leading engineering teams - hiring, coaching, performance management, and building engineering delivery culture within a platform or infrastructure organization.
Strong cloud infrastructure and platform engineering expertise - AWS required (hands-on operational depth); Azure and GCP experience valued; Kubernetes and container orchestration, Infrastructure-as-Code, and CI/CD platform operations at production scale.
Demonstrated reliability engineering experience - SLO/SLI design, incident management, production readiness practices, and observability across high-availability, distributed systems.
Database engineering and operational data infrastructure experience - managing relational and cloud-native databases at production scale, with exposure to data platform infrastructure (lakehouse, streaming, or orchestration systems) a strong plus.
Familiarity with AI infrastructure and ML platform operations - inference runtimes, agent orchestration infrastructure, GPU/compute platform management, or operational AI platform support sufficient to lead effective teams in these domains.
FinOps and cost management discipline - tracking cloud spend, driving capacity efficiency, eliminating waste, and communicating cost tradeoffs clearly.
Strong cross-team collaboration and communication skills - able to coordinate effectively with AI Engineering, Product Engineering, Security, Data, Finance, and centralized Platform Engineering teams, and to represent Foundations Engineering planning and progress to senior stakeholders.
Preferred Qualifications
Experience in online advertising technology - familiarity with ad serving systems, programmatic platforms, campaign management, or streaming ad delivery infrastructure.
Experience building or contributing to an internal developer platform (IDP) - self-service engineering tooling, golden-path frameworks, platform abstractions, or developer experience improvements at scale.
Familiarity with Databricks, Snowflake, Apache Kafka, or similar cloud-native data platform technologies used in lakehouse or real-time streaming infrastructure.
Experience with AI/ML runtime infrastructure - vector databases, embedding pipelines, model serving, inference systems, or agent execution platforms.
Background in high-availability, high-scale real-time systems - live streaming, live advertising, event-driven architectures, or real-time bidding - operating across multi-cloud environments.
Demonstrated practice in automation-first operational models - reducing operational toil through tooling, scripting, platform engineering, and infrastructure automation rather than manual processes.
Required Education
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field; advanced degree preferred.
